use crate::api;
use crate::api::client;
use crate::error::OxenError;
use crate::model::RemoteRepository;
use crate::view::merge::{MergeResult, MergeSuccessResponse, Mergeable, MergeableResponse};
pub async fn mergeable(
remote_repo: &RemoteRepository,
base: &str,
head: &str,
) -> Result<Mergeable, OxenError> {
let uri = format!("/merge/{base}..{head}");
let url = api::endpoint::url_from_repo(remote_repo, &uri)?;
log::debug!("api::client::merger::mergeability url: {url}");
let client = client::new_for_url(&url)?;
let res = client.get(&url).send().await?;
let body = client::parse_json_body(&url, res).await?;
let response: MergeableResponse = serde_json::from_str(&body)?;
Ok(response.mergeable)
}
pub async fn merge(
remote_repo: &RemoteRepository,
base: &str,
head: &str,
) -> Result<MergeResult, OxenError> {
let uri = format!("/merge/{base}..{head}");
let url = api::endpoint::url_from_repo(remote_repo, &uri)?;
log::debug!("api::client::merger::merge url: {url}");
let client = client::new_for_url(&url)?;
let res = client.post(&url).send().await?;
let body = client::parse_json_body(&url, res).await?;
let response: MergeSuccessResponse = serde_json::from_str(&body)?;
Ok(response.commits)
}
